About this school

Stoke Canon Church of England Primary School and Pre-School is a Church of England voluntary controlled primary school in Exeter. It teaches children aged 2 to 11 and has 85 pupils on roll.

Exam results

Key stage 2 (end of primary school)

Measure 2022/23 2023/24 2024/25
Pupils at the end of key stage 2 11 13 12
Met the expected standard in reading, writing and maths 73% 69% 58%
Reached the higher standard in reading, writing and maths 9% 0% 0%
Expected standard in reading 91% 92% 58%
Expected standard in maths 73% 69% 67%
Expected standard in grammar, punctuation and spelling 73% 62% 42%
Average scaled score in reading 106.0 106.0 104.0
Average scaled score in maths 103.0 101.0 103.0
Reading progress +2.80 - -
Writing progress +5.00 - -
Maths progress +1.50 - -

Progress measures ended nationally after the 2022/23 school year, when the key stage 1 assessments they were based on were stopped. Blank progress figures in later years are not missing school data.

How Stoke Canon Church of England Primary School and Pre-School compares

Stoke Canon Church of England Primary School and Pre-School ranked 156th of 269 primary schools in Devon for KS2 results in 2024/25. Its KS2 result was higher than 36% of England primary schools that published results in 2024/25. Its absence rate was lower than 76% of England schools in 2024/25.
